I don't know whether you know this recipe, but I thought I would share in case you don't! It actually comes from "What to expect when you're expecting" pregnancy guide (Murkoff, Eisenberg and Hathaway), but is perfect for the IBS diet and lets me eat fries again, hooray!
For 2 servings:
1 1/2 teaspoons Canola oil (I use sunflower oil, because I actually can't tolerate Canola at all) 2 large baking potatoes 2 large egg whites
Preheat the oven to 220 degrees C/450 F. Grease a nonstick baking sheet with the oil. Scrub the potatoes, pat dry and cut into 6mm (1/4 inch)-thick slices, then cut into chips of the desired length and pat dry again. Place egg whites into a medium sized bowl and whisk until foamy. Add the potatoes, toss until coated with egg white. Arrange the fries in a single layer on the baking sheet and bake until crisp and lightly browned outside, tender inside (about 30-35 mins). Eat with salt and pepper as desired.
